Add message checks for out of process logging.
<rdar://problem/117915276>
Pull request: https://github.com/WebKit/WebKit/pull/19962
Committed 270217@main (a8769489a963): <https://commits.webkit.org/270217@main> Reviewed commits have been landed. Closing PR #19962 and removing active labels.